Vegans vs. Not-Vegan-Enough

There’s no other way to address this issue but to say plainly that Angry Vegans are not helping the plant-based diet cause. We know you are angry! We get it! Someone thought it better to raise livestock for slaughter over something less slaughter-ish, like, say, eating beans. We agree. It was stupid. It is stupid. And one day, we promise you that the Sisters here in Merced will get drunk enough to break into Foster Farms and free the chickens. We will do that. We’ve heard real nuns do shit like that and we want to emulate them. It’s on our bucket list. Promise.

After three years of failing at veganism, this past January, as new years’ resolutions swirled around us, we decided to take a much more practical approach to our dietary restrictions. And a religious approach. ‘Religious’ means ‘have fun with it for no apparent planetary reason, just imaginary reasons’.

  1. New Moon to Full Moon – Strictly No Meat, with exceptions: see #3, #4, #5, #6
  2. Full Moon to New Moon – Meat Is Permitted Daily, once per day only and not to be mixed with cheese, eggs or other animal by-product foods
  3. Holy Sacred Meat is Bacon*** is an exception to all rules, but in moderation / as a seasoning / never more than 2 slices of bacon in a 24-hour period
  4. All food rules are waived if you are sick or pregnant
  5. We are Activists and in Service Daily to the People, we cannot afford to go to bed hungry. If your stomach is growling at bed-time, you are allowed to eat meat.
  6. You are allowed to eat meat that was prepared prior to the new moon and would be thrown away if not eaten (make no waste of sacrificial meat)
  7. Never mix meat with the milk or dairy or by-products from the same animal
  8. Meat is allowed at restaurants when traveling, but only once per trip (if in moon cycle)

Why is bacon the sacred exception? Because Sister Kate’s Chinese astrology sign is the Pig. This is just as reasonable as saying twenty million Catholics will eat meat on Friday. Their reason was because the Catholic church invested in fisheries. At least my reason has no economic motive.

We are Beguine revivalists. Our ancient mothers had to have eight children to see two of them turn eighteen years old. That means they buried three of four children they gave birth do. We think that had a lot to do with diet. We don’t think ‘no meat’ is the way. We certainly think WAY LESS MEAT is the way. And we think every family and tribe should find its own path to a plant-based diet. We think the more creative that path, the better. Here’s the thing, though. You can’t hate on people for not being vegan purists. If you do, you lose the battle of moving more plant-based.
